--- Alan Smith <email@hidden> wrote:

> Hi Ian,
>
> NSMatrix just so happens to have a method called
> setCellSize:. It
> would be used like this:
>
> [yourmatrix setCellSize: [youricon size]];
>
> That should work nicely.
